The M6 motorway closure caused delays of up to one hour and required an air ambulance landing to assist after a serious multi-vehicle crash, officials said.
- A major multi-vehicle accident on August 16, 2025, led to the closure of the M6 motorway in both directions near Walsall, specifically between junctions 10 and 11.
- The crash led authorities to stop traffic around 11am and involved emergency services including fire, ambulance, and an air ambulance landing on the motorway.
- The motorway began reopening by early afternoon with two of four lanes still closed for vehicle recovery as traffic was held northbound for the air ambulance.
- National Highways classified the incident as a serious injury collision and advised motorists to find alternative routes to avoid around 30-minute delays in both directions.
- Heavy traffic persisted on surrounding roads near Wolverhampton and Birmingham, and police thanked the public for their assistance and patience during the closure.
